- A true New York-style Deli had been missing from Boulder for a long time until Jimmy & Drew's Deli opened. Located about 4 blocks north of the 29th Street Mall, Jimmy & Drew's can be found in a nondescript strip mall with a Mexican eatery, a bakery, a Vietnamese restaurant, an Asian market, and an Indian market. While other delis may brag about the ingredients they import from New York and Chicago, at Jimmy and Drew's, chef Andrew "Drew" Marx makes just about everything on-site, even smoking his own pastrami and salmon. If you're in the mood for some matzoh ball soup, pastrami on rye, and a black-and-white cookie, Jimmy & Drew's Deli is the place to go.
